It is believed that strong ferromagnetic orders in some solids are generated by subtle interplay between quantum many-body effects and spin-independent Coulomb interactions between electrons. Here we describe our rigorous and constructive approach to ferromagnetism in the Hubbard model, which is a standard idealized model for strongly interacting electrons in a solid. We present, for the first time, a class of nonsingular Hubbard models in any dimensions which are proved to exhibit saturated ferromagnetism. (Here a nonsingular model means a many electron system in which neither Coulomb interaction nor the density of states at the Fermi level is infinite.) Combined with our earlier results, the present work provides nonsingular models of itinerant electrons (with only spin-independent interactions) where low energy behaviors are proved to be that of a healthy ferromagnetic insulator. 2 00 3 Renormalization group analysis of magnetic and superconducting instabilities near van Hove band fillings

Phase diagrams of the two-dimensional one-band t-t ′ Hubbard model are obtained within the two-patch and the temperature-cutoff many-patch renor-malization group approach. At small t ′ and at van Hove band fillings anti-ferromagnetism dominates, while with increasing t ′ or changing filling anti-ferromagnetism is replaced by d-wave superconductivity. Ground states of the spin-1 Bose-Hubbard model.

We prove basic theorems about the ground states of the S=1 Bose-Hubbard model. The results are quite universal and depend only on the coefficient U2 of the spin-dependent interaction. We show that the ground state exhibits saturated ferromagnetism if U2<0, is spin-singlet if U2>0, and exhibits "SU(3)-ferromagnetism" if U2=0, and completely determine the degeneracy in each region.
